Practical Approaches for Online Growth
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on the links between thoughts, feelings, and behaviors and helps clients learn skills to challenge unhelpful thinking and build more effective habits; it is often used for anxiety, depression, and stress-related concerns. Solution-Focused Therapy emphasizes identifying small, concrete steps and existing strengths so clients can make progress quickly toward specific goals and notice measurable change.
